The torque on a bar magnet due to the earth's magnetic field is maximum when the axis of the magnet is

A

Perpendicular to the field of the earth

B

Parallel to the vertical component of the earth's field

C

At an angle of 33o with respect to the N-S direction

D

Along the North-South (N-S) direction

Answer

Perpendicular to the field of the earth

Explanation

Solution

Torque on a bar magnet in earths magnetic field (BH) is τ=MBHsinθ\tau = M B _ { H } \sin \theta τ will be maximum if sin θ = maximum i.e. θ = 90o. Hence axis of the magnet is perpendicular to the field of earth.
